MEA gets Rs.62.9 bn budget allocation

By IANS,

New Delhi : The ministry of external affairs has seen a slight dip in its allocation under the union budget at Rs.6,293 crore (Rs.62.9 billion) – a decrease of 8 percent from the previous revised budget estimates.

For 2008-09, the ministry had been allocated Rs.5,062 crore, which was revised to Rs.6,868 crore. This was however scaled down a little to Rs.6,293 crore for 2009-10.

The biggest change in fund distribution within the ministry has been under “international cooperation”, where it has dipped from Rs.1,015.5 crore in the 2008-09 revised estimate, down to Rs.287 crore – a drop of nearly 80 percent.
